How HTML5 Transformed Modern Browser Games #26
1. Introduction: The Evolution of Browser-Based Gaming and the Significance of HTML5
Browser-based gaming has experienced a remarkable transformation over the past two decades. Initially, the web served as a platform for simple, 2D games that could be played directly within browsers, mainly relying on technologies like Java applets or early Flash implementations. These games offered limited graphics, basic interactions, and often suffered from performance issues.
The limitations of earlier web technologies, especially Flash, included dependency on proprietary plugins, security vulnerabilities, and inconsistent performance across different browsers and devices. These issues hindered developers from creating more immersive, complex gaming experiences and restricted gameplay to desktop environments.
The advent of HTML5 marked a watershed moment. As a standardized, open web technology, HTML5 provided native support for multimedia, graphics, and interactive content. This shift unlocked new possibilities for browser games, enabling developers to craft richer, more engaging experiences without relying on external plugins. The emergence of HTML5 thus fundamentally changed the landscape of web gaming, making it more accessible, secure, and versatile.
2. Core Features of HTML5 That Transformed Browser Games
- Native multimedia support: HTML5 introduced audio, video, and canvas elements, allowing games to incorporate rich media directly within the browser environment, eliminating the need for third-party plugins.
- Advanced Canvas API: This API enables dynamic, scriptable rendering of 2D graphics in real-time, empowering developers to create complex visual effects, animations, and interactive interfaces.
- Performance improvements: HTML5 leverages hardware acceleration through technologies like WebGL, facilitating smoother graphics rendering and more demanding gameplay mechanics.
- Enhanced security and portability: As an open standard, HTML5 ensures consistent behavior across browsers and devices, reducing security risks and broadening accessibility.
3. How HTML5 Enabled the Development of Complex, Rich Browser Games
One of HTML5’s most significant impacts was empowering developers to transition from simple 2D games to sophisticated 3D environments. Utilizing WebGL, a JavaScript API for rendering high-performance interactive 3D graphics within browsers, creators could craft immersive worlds that rivaled native applications.
Moreover, HTML5’s capabilities facilitated real-time multiplayer interactions. Technologies like WebSockets provided low-latency communication channels, enabling players worldwide to compete, cooperate, and communicate seamlessly within browser games. This interconnectedness fostered social gaming experiences directly accessible from any device with an internet connection.
Integration with social media platforms and cloud services further enhanced engagement, allowing players to share achievements, invite friends, and save progress across devices. These innovations collectively transformed browser gaming into a vibrant, interconnected industry.
4. Case Study: Modern Examples of Browser Games Built with HTML5
| Game Title | HTML5 Features Used | Gameplay Highlights |
|---|---|---|
| Chicken Road 2 | Canvas API, WebGL, Web Workers | Engaging arcade gameplay with smooth animations, multiplayer modes, and cross-device compatibility, exemplifying HTML5’s capabilities. |
| Slither.io | Canvas API, WebSockets | Real-time multiplayer snake game with seamless controls and social sharing features. |
| Agar.io | Canvas API, Web Workers | Massive multiplayer battles with smooth graphics and responsive mechanics, demonstrating HTML5’s scalability. |
As seen in HARDCORE, HTML5 enables developers to craft engaging, high-performance browser games that are accessible across devices, fostering a broader gaming community and richer player experiences.
5. The Impact of Cultural and Numerical Factors in HTML5 Game Design
Cultural themes and numerical symbolism play a crucial role in game design, tapping into players’ subconscious associations to heighten engagement. For example, many Asian casinos consider the number 8 as a symbol of luck and prosperity, influencing game mechanics and betting patterns to attract culturally inclined audiences.
In terms of visual mechanics, incorporating peripheral vision — such as a chicken that sees 300 degrees around it — informs AI behavior and game mechanics. This understanding of spatial awareness enables developers to create more realistic and challenging AI opponents, as well as intuitive gameplay that leverages human visual perception.
Furthermore, leveraging familiar references like McDonald’s Chicken McNuggets sales statistics can make game content more relatable and memorable, fostering emotional connections and encouraging repeated play. These elements underscore how HTML5’s flexibility allows for the integration of culturally and numerically meaningful symbols into game narratives and mechanics.
6. Technical Innovations in HTML5 that Boosted Browser Game Development
- WebGL: Facilitates rendering of detailed 3D graphics within browsers, enabling immersive environments that previously required native applications.
- Web Workers: Allow execution of complex calculations in background threads, preventing gameplay lag and ensuring smooth performance even during intensive tasks.
- Mobile optimization: Responsive design techniques and touch-friendly interfaces ensure games are playable on smartphones and tablets, expanding accessibility and user base.
7. Non-Obvious Depth: The Intersection of HTML5 and Gaming Psychology
Visual and auditory enhancements made possible by HTML5 significantly influence player immersion. High-quality sound effects, background music, and vivid visuals stimulate the senses, fostering a sense of presence within the game world. For example, the rhythmic sounds and bright graphics of a game like HARDCORE contribute to a more engaging experience.
Psychologically, culturally significant symbols and numbers can evoke positive emotions or auspicious feelings, encouraging players to spend more time and money in the game. Additionally, understanding peripheral vision and spatial awareness allows designers to craft mechanics that exploit human instinct, such as requiring players to monitor multiple zones simultaneously, increasing game complexity and engagement.
8. Challenges and Limitations of HTML5 in Gaming
- Performance issues on low-end devices: Despite hardware acceleration, HTML5 games may struggle on older or less powerful hardware due to limited processing power.
- Browser fragmentation: Variations in how browsers implement HTML5 standards can lead to inconsistent experiences, necessitating extensive testing and optimization.
- Future prospects: Ongoing improvements in web standards, browser technologies, and hardware promise to address current limitations, expanding HTML5’s capabilities.
9. Conclusion: The Continuing Influence of HTML5 on the Future of Browser Gaming
HTML5 has democratized game development by removing barriers associated with proprietary plugins and enabling a broad range of developers to create high-quality browser experiences. Its open standards foster innovation, cross-platform compatibility, and accessibility, shaping the future trajectory of web gaming.
Emerging technologies, such as WebAssembly and improved WebGL standards, build upon HTML5 foundations to further enhance performance and visual fidelity. As a result, browser games are poised to become even more immersive, social, and culturally relevant—continually evolving the landscape of digital entertainment.
“HTML5’s flexibility and power have transformed browser gaming from simple entertainment into a complex, socially connected industry that appeals to diverse audiences worldwide.”
In summary, HTML5’s innovations have not only expanded what is technically possible but also reshaped the cultural and psychological dimensions of gaming, ensuring its enduring influence on the industry’s future.